Route description
We start this easy cycle route in the center of Špindlerův Mlýn, from where we go through Tabulové boudy to the Elbe dam.
After stopping and seeing the Elbe dam, take your bike to its other bank, where you continue a short distance along the dam and then turn left, where you continue along Honza's ditch to Labská - southern edge, where you will connect to route no. K11, which will take you to Třídomí.
From Třídomí you will then go back along the same cycle route with no. K11 and you will continue along it further and further until you reach the Bedřiška Hotel. You will return to Špindlerův Mlýn along the other bank of the Elbe. From the Bedřiška Hotel it is not far to the very center of Špindlerův Mlýn, where our bike trip began.
The cycle route is perfect for all bike lovers, children and especially for those who want to look further than just the Elbe Dam by bike.

Its construction began in 1910. This dam is located at an altitude of 694.16 m above sea level. The dam is based on orthogneisses at a depth of 4–7 m below the surface of the terrain. The foundation of the right-bank dam spillway and cascades is up to 16 m below the surface. The gravity arched masonry dam of the Intze type with a backfill is made of local gneiss stone on traso-cement mortar. The maximum height of the dam crest above the base joint is 41.5 m. The length of the dam in the crown is 153.5 m and the width of the dam in the crown is 6.15 m.
